“Respect Our Father’s Legacy,” Late Alaafin’s Children Tell Ex-Wife Dami

The late Alaafin of Oyo, Lamidi Adeyemi’s children, have warned his ex-wife, Damilola Adeyemi, against alleged defamatory remarks about their father.

Aminat Adeyemi, a daughter of the late monarch, shared a letter on Instagram on Friday, warning Dami to stop “tarnishing our father’s reputation.”

Her remarks on their family were deemed “disrespectful and damaging” by the Alaafin children in the letter dated January 22.

Additionally, they vowed to take legal action if Dami keeps using their father’s name in interviews.

“It has come to our attention that DAMILOLA SUKURAT MOSHOOD (popularly called Queen Dami) has been making public remarks regarding our late father in various interviews,” the letter reads.

“While we respect everyone’s freedom of speech, we find it necessary to address this matter as these statements have become increasingly disrespectful and harmful to our family’s reputation.

“We hereby request that you cease making any further public statements involving our late father’s name or legacy.

“These comments are not only inaccurate but also unnecessary, especially considering your prior status and circumstances. You are no longer a part of the family or his legacy, and as such, we expect you to respect the boundaries of our family matters.

“We urge you to pursue your endeavors without dragging our father’s name into public conversations.

“Any further remarks that tarnish his memory or our family name will not be tolerated, and we reserve the right to take appropriate legal or reputational actions if necessary.

“We hope this serves as a clear and final warning. Let us all move forward with dignity and respect.”

Alaafin died in April 2022. Dami and singer Portable, who began dating in 2023, have been in the news owing to several controversies.
